It seems the Forsaken are usually somewhat constricted and not allowed to massively attack main players on the Lightside yet, because they seem to be more valuable as pawns, e.g. Egwene (the Cleansing was an exception, though, and Moridin at least gave the order now to kill the other two ta'veren). This is also illustrated by the fact that Moridin even personally saves Rand's life during the confrontation with Sammael in the end of ACoS. I really hope all this will make sense in the end, when/if we eventually learn the real "master plan" of the DO.
In the AoL it took 50 years of the "Collapse" before the DO and his minions were powerful enough to strike. Obviously in the current Age it's a easier to create Chaos and thus fuel the DOs power. Each of the main characters would have been easy sources for generating Chaos, or at least prolonging existing Chaos (as with Egwene). Why kill off such a valuable source? Note that Mesaana has no problem having Egwene deposed once they realize she is actually "a woman in with a girls face".
